Francisco José Recinos Molina★★★★

Smaller than other Harris Teeter locations outside of Uptown, but great for covering basic needs. Convenient location for quick grocery runs. Clean store with fresh produce, a solid bakery section, good deli for a quick sandwich or a pizza slice and a nice wine selection. Not ideal for full grocery shopping, but it gets the job done well for city living.

Анна Агрич★★★★★

There is a wide assortment of food and drinks, and everything is fresh. Inside the store, there is a wonderful bar featuring draft beer; you can sample a wide variety of brews to find the one that best suits your taste! The friendly staff is ready to offer recommendations and provide personal attention to every customer.

Crystal H★★★★

Very nice store, attentive staff. Great variety of offerings from pizza, ready made sandwiches, seafood. One thing to note: there are no cashiers. Self check out only.

John hudson★★★

Its a smaller HT but it gets it job done especially non busy hour, I'm usually in and out. However during 6pm or noon good luck, the self checkout are always stuck or broken and you got one person helping out at the counter and the self check outs. There's very few parking spots and you'll be dodging some of the homeless people there. During busy hours I rather just drive a few more blocks and go to the HT on East or South.
